diff options
author | Jason Penilla <[email protected]> | 2023-12-06 15:32:08 -0700 |
---|---|---|
committer | Jason Penilla <[email protected]> | 2023-12-06 15:32:08 -0700 |
commit | ada77b3a3b3d1109d960b3f31121c9d0903874d5 (patch) | |
tree | ac4a453182d2dd412f9fc97886facfe1094dba17 /build.gradle.kts | |
parent | 6bafacfb14a67bb6c10fe9dd5bcc76e6b74b47e0 (diff) | |
download | Paper-ada77b3a3b3d1109d960b3f31121c9d0903874d5.tar.gz Paper-ada77b3a3b3d1109d960b3f31121c9d0903874d5.zip |
Wait on stream redirect futures (update helper task)
Diffstat (limited to 'build.gradle.kts')
-rw-r--r-- | build.gradle.kts |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/build.gradle.kts b/build.gradle.kts index 0b8b21a5fa..5d4dae473e 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-207,9 +207,10 @@ abstract class RebasePatches : BaseTask() { .redirectErrorStream(true) .start() - redirect(proc.inputStream, out) + val f = redirect(proc.inputStream, out) val exit = proc.waitFor() + f.get() if (exit != 0) { val outStr = String(out.toByteArray()) @@ -251,8 +252,9 @@ abstract class RebasePatches : BaseTask() { .redirectErrorStream(true) .start() - redirect(apply2.inputStream, System.out) + val f1 = redirect(apply2.inputStream, System.out) apply2.waitFor() + f1.get() logger.lifecycle(outStr) logger.lifecycle("Patch failed at $failed; See Git output above.") |